Assignment Details#
Part 1: Model and Build the prototype
Describe and design how priorities shift (if at all) between the terrestrial building (A2-A3) and the space station deployment for your system
Design and model your space within the prototype to demonstrate the key stages and features identified in your A3 preliminary design
Create a drawing or diagram showing the spatial connections, interfaces, and interactions between your system and at least two other group systems within the space station
Integrate your physical prototype into the shared hyper space tent installation, ensuring it connects and interacts logically with systems designed by other groups, describing how you have done so
Document how your system adapts to the unique constraints and opportunities of the low orbit space station environment.
Describe your model, your space, and your systems within it
Part 2: Draw the Growth table of your space (eg, living room, control room) based on your system (eg, roof)
Draw the Growth table ( stages, functions, features, etc)
Describe the functional and spatial requirements at each stage
Document the dependencies on other systems, their growth stages and how that connects
